Job Purpose:
The Center Academic Manager (CAM) is responsible for the implementation and administration of all aspects of the academic program, management of the academic team and their performance, ensuring that all students benefit from the program.
Work Schedule:
This is a residential position (full board & dorm accommodation are included)
A flexible work approach towards the position with the ability to work nights, weekends and holidays is required.
Key Responsibilities:
- Ensure the delivery of quality customer satisfaction by providing and delivering a high-quality academic program
- Organize and manage the academic timetable and course planning
- Organize and manage placement testing for students upon arrival, and the appropriate placing of students into classes based on test results
- Manage the appropriate use of academic materials and resources
- Ensure that lessons are integrated, following our syllabi and guidelines
- Support, monitor and guide teachers through lesson observations and feedback
- Maintain recommended staffing based on student levels and ratios
- Contribute to student”s development of life skills through program assistance
- Teach when required, to meet operational needs
- Ensure that all students complete an End of Program questionnaire and are presented with a certificate of achievement and report (correctly completed) before departure
- Respond to and deal with student and Group Leader inquiries regarding classes and levels
- Establish a positive working environment with the teaching staff
- Review and approve all teacher timesheets in collaboration with the Center Manager
- Liaise regularly with the Center Manager and Group Leaders to ensure that high levels of student safety, welfare and discipline are maintained
- Help and assist in running the center temporarily in the absence of the Center Manager or Activity Manager, and during the weekends
- In collaboration with the Center Manager and other center management staff, to carry out a 24-hour emergency on-call rotation schedule
- Lead and participate in weekly meetings with group leaders
- Lead in the professional development of teachers by performing weekly observations and providing immediate and constructive feedback during the course of the program to ensure delivery of a high quality academic program
- Lead with coordinating student arrivals and departures while assisted by the Center Manager
Qualifications & Training:
- Experience managing an academic staff including hiring, training and team building
- 2+ years of ESL teaching experience; proven experience teaching ESL to a wide variety of levels and age groups with demonstrated effective teaching methods
- Experience and familiarity with continuous enrollment courses and weekly intakes
- Native level of fluency in English
- Bachelor”s degree plus MA TESOL, TEFL Certification
- Effective communication (written and verbal) and supervisory skills
- Proven excellent time management, organizational and multi-tasking skills
- Demonstrated flexibility and ability to work with a team in a varied and fast-paced role in a high pressure environment
- Ability to lead and inspire teaching staff
- Working knowledge of computers and Word and Excel programs
- Valid First Aid and/or CPR Certificate (Desirable)
- Lifeguard and/or other coaching qualification (Desirable)
